How to Play The Best Russian Billiards

Primary Objective: Be the first player to legally pocket 8 balls. The game ends when a player reaches this goal. You'll lose if your opponent pockets 8 balls before you do.

The core mechanic involves using your mouse or finger to control the cue stick. You'll aim by moving your cursor around the cue ball. To shoot, just click and hold (or tap and hold on mobile), pull back to set the power, and release to strike. The power meter on the side provides a clear visual indicator of your shot strength. Your turn continues as long as you legally pocket a ball. But watch out, fouls like pocketing the cue ball will result in the loss of your turn.

A fundamental strategy is to always think one shot ahead. Rather than just sinking the easiest ball, consider where your cue ball will stop after the shot. We found in our data that players who maintain good cue ball position win over 60% more matches. A common mistake is using maximum power for every shot; this often leads to poor positioning and makes the game harder. Use your finesse to control the table.

Tips and Tricks for The Best Russian Billiards

  1. Master the 50% Power Shot. Take it from us, shots made between 40% and 60% power offer the best balance of pocketing success and cue ball control. Save high-power shots for breaking or when it's absolutely necessary.
  2. Learn Basic Spin Control. Applying a small amount of top spin by adjusting the impact point just 10-15% above centre will help the cue ball travel forward after impact, setting up your next shot.
  3. Play Defensive Shots. If you don't have a clear shot, play a 'safety'. Just tap a ball gently (under 20% power) to move it to a difficult position for your opponent. Our AI is programmed to respect and react to strong defensive play.
  4. Understand Bank Angles. We designed the cushion physics with a consistent rebound factor of 0.8. This means a ball hitting the rail at a 30-degree angle will rebound at approximately 24 degrees. You can use this knowledge for some amazing bank shots.
  5. Break with Purpose. Don't just smash the rack. A controlled break shot at 75% power aimed just off-centre of the lead ball provides a more predictable and effective spread, increasing your chance of pocketing a ball on the break by 25%.
